2008-08-05 - Identified through online information from James R. Stettner. -- Case of oiled white oak. 3-sectional facade of 85 pipes arranged: 9-30-7-30-9. The two flats of 30 pipes are divided into upper and lower sections of 15 pipes each. Pedal 8' Octave has pipes 1-12 in common with Great 8' Principal. W.P. = 75mm. "Bach" temperament by H.A. Kellner, 1978. -Database Manager

Millstone, New Jersey Hillsborough Reformed Church Charles M. Ruggles Opus 22 1991 2 manuals, 18 stops, 24 ranks _______________________________________ GREAT ORGAN 8' Principal 56 8' Rohrflöte 56 4' Octave 56 2' Octave 56 Mixtur III-V 224? 8' Trumpet 56 Swell to Great SWELL ORGAN 8' Gedackt 56 4' Principal 56 4' Flute 56 2 2/3' Nasard 56 2' Blockflöte 56 1 3/5' Tierce 56 Scharf III-IV 212? 8' Dulcian 56 PEDAL ORGAN 16' Subbass 30 8' Octave 18 a 16' Trombone 30 8' Trumpet (ext 16') 12 Great to Pedal Swell to Pedal a 1-12 from GT 8' Principal General Tremulant [Received from Steven E.
